## Timezones in report exports

Welcome to team Parchwick! Quick heads-up: all report exports from Tallygram are generated in UTC internally, then shifted to the customer's chosen zone at render time. Don't try to be clever and convert earlier — it breaks DST edges. Exports also need the signing credential loaded locally. Add the following line to your env file:

sealed setting: LEDGER_TOKEN13=5d842615a26d7

Q: Why does the Slimcask pipeline strip the debug layer from our images?
A: Smaller images mean faster cold starts on the Bramblefield fleet and a reduced patch surface. Debug variants are still built nightly, stored in a sealed registry vault. To pull one, unseal the vault first — the recovery passphrase is below.

recovery phrase for fajep-yaweg: gilath-sorox-wenius-rusdor-keliel-zorius

Broker upgrade notes for the weekly sync: we are moving the Corvalle message broker from the 2.x line to 3.1 across the Netherfield cluster this sprint. Consumers on the Ashgrove service are already compatible; the Pellway workers need the new acknowledgment mode flag before cutover. Expect a brief replay window while partitions rebalance, roughly ten minutes per shard. One action item for whoever runs the cutover: the 3.1 broker enforces authenticated connections, so add the broker credential on the following line.

vault entry, yahif-yajep: COURIER_KEY29=b802bdf8034096b65a51c6ba5abe2